Hand Picked Hotels celebrates Green Tourism success across the Channel Islands
Hand Picked Hotels is proud to announce that all five of its Channel Islands properties have achieved Green Tourism accreditation, recognising the group’s commitment to more responsible and sustainable hospitality across the islands.
Green Tourism assesses businesses against rigorous criteria grouped under the three pillars of people, place and planet. Hand Picked Hotels is at the beginning of its journey towards championing sustainable tourism. Working with a world-leading sustainability certification partner for travel, tourism and hospitality businesses, the group aims to embed responsible, sustainable and environmentally friendly practices across its properties and the wider tourism sector. Each property is assessed and awarded a Gold, Silver, or Bronze rating based on its performance.
Within the Channel Islands, Fermain Valley Hotel, St Pierre Park Hotel, Spa & Golf Resort, Grand Jersey Hotel & Spa and Braye Beach Hotel achieved Silver status, reflecting strong and consistent sustainability progress. L’Horizon Beach Hotel & Spa achieved Bronze, marking a positive foundation for continued environmental improvements.

To achieve accreditation, Hand Picked Hotels implemented a wide range of initiatives. Dedicated sustainability teams were established at every property, supported by detailed Green Action Plans with measurable targets. The group’s Sustainability Policy and Our Green Story are published online, outlining initiatives such as expanding local and seasonal sourcing, planting wildflower meadows, creating wildlife habitats and upgrading energy systems with LED lighting, sensors and timers.
Ongoing improvements include specialist sustainability training, community projects such as local clean-ups and planting schemes, expansion of EV charging and investment in water-saving systems and energy-efficient appliances.
The achievement forms part of a wider milestone for Hand Picked Hotels, with all 21 of its hotels across the UK and Channel Islands now accredited by Green Tourism, the world’s leading sustainability certification programme for the travel and hospitality industry.
